WebFeb 13, 2024 · Divide your objectives into 1 general and 3-4 specific ones. In many research proposals, the proper format is a general or long-term objective followed by a few specific ones. The general objective is essentially what you hope to achieve with the project. The specific objectives are the building blocks of that general goal. WebDefine Scope of the Project. WebFeb 3, 2024 · List three to five objectives of the project, be SMART: specific, measurable, achievable, realistic and time-bound. Scope. Now outline the formal boundaries of the project by describing how the business may change or alter by the delivery of your project, also note what’s relevant to the scope of work and what is not.
